The City of Austin announced a new bonus structure for seasonal employees.
The new bonus program is tied to how many hours an employee works with a max payout of $750. At 200 hours worked, an employee receives a $250 bonus. Other incentives include free bus passes and free parking at Zilker Park.
Lifeguards must be at least 15-years-old, and summer camp staff must be at least 18-years-old. Apply to be a lifeguard atLearn more and apply now at
